Day 5 Monmouth to Clun and a Reunion




"This is perhaps the easiest day’s ride of the tour. It is the shortest in terms of cycling & while there are a few hills to tackle, notably away from Monmouth & at the end of the day towards Clun the route is generally quite easy. Today is also one of the most scenic days with many hidden gems






The description failed to explain that the climb would be concentrated into the last third of the route, with two rather nasty sections (several people bailed out) that lead to a white knuckle descent to the ford at Clun. 

It was despite this a glorious ride especially  the section in Shropshire, a county  which continues to reveal new treasures on every visit even after over 30 years.
